About the area

Grove Park is a historic residential Westside Atlanta neighborhood characterized by mid-century bungalows, lush green spaces, and community-driven revitalization. It borders Atlanta's expansive Westside Park and the developing BeltLine corridor, though commercial pedestrian infrastructure remains developing and inconsistent.

Walking and biking in Grove Park

Walk score: 48/100 · Bike score: 45/100

Westside Park offers excellent paved trail connections toward the Atlanta BeltLine Westside Trail, though dedicated bike lanes on neighborhood roadways remain scarce.

Transit, parking and getting around

The Bankhead MARTA rail station (Green Line) sits on the eastern edge roughly a 10-to-15-minute walk away, while MARTA Bus routes 51 and 58 provide east-west transit along Donald Lee Hollowell Parkway.

Street parking is generally free and plentiful along residential streets, and Westside Park offers free dedicated surface lot parking.
